I had a good trip as well this weekend. Thanks for the report. I threw a wart on Saturday and caught some nice fish but you had to cover a lot of water and I mean a lot. I had one I would say close to 8lbs and break my off on the boat on a wart when I was trying to lip him. Did not ha e the net out and I did not retie for quite some time so it was my fault. Man he fought and was a huge rush and let down at the same time. Lost my all time favorite wart that was a fish catcher. After that I decided to go deep because I knew they were biting out there but just wanted to get them shallow. I know there is a shallow bite somewhere but I have no idea why there isn't a bunch of fish up shallow right now. I also went into big creeks and caught them in deep of water as 70 in about 30-40 feet and also caught some on the bottom or close in about 35ft. Caught a lot of nice K's and SM and a few LM on spoon. Threw the A-rig quite a bit and caught some nice ones but not a lot. They should be all over that as well and they probably are somewhere but I didn't find them. I think at any time the shallow bite should develop as well as the arig but I could be wrong. This weather might throw them a curveball. I really think the water needs to get a little colder. It was 56-58 degrees. Fished deep again Sunday and caught them as well. It seemed they did not like when you got over them and had to cast to them. They were really finicky but once you got them to bite you could get them going. Can't wait to get back down next week.

Getting Close to Hair Jig Time........
Alex Heitman replied to Mitch f's topic in General Angling Discussion
If any of you watched the BFL All American on NBC sports yesterday it was awesome. A local named Jeremy Lawyer the SW MO area did really well and about won it with a 2nd place finish. I've fished some of the BFL's and talked to him. He is a great fisherman and an even better guy. He was throwing a big hair jig with a swimbait trailer on Kentucky Lake. He would throw it out let it sink down a ways and then crank super fast 3-4 times and stop. It was a really neat presentation to watch and gave me some knowledge. The Quest for Winter Gloves
Alex Heitman replied to JestersHK's topic in Equipment - Rods/Reels/Line/and all the other toys
I have found out its best to just wear cheap cotton gloves and just cut the tips off the thumb and first two fingers. Just try not to get your hands and gloves wet. Another thing you can do is wear the thick latex cleaning gloves underneath to keep them waterproof. All of the fishing waterproof gloves I have had are too stiff and make you lose the sensitivity you need while fishing. -
